Amazon Operations is the backbone of the Amazon customer experience. With over 50 fulfilment centres, hundreds of delivery stations, and tens of thousands of employees, the team works together to efficiently deliver items to customers. In the fulfilment centres, millions of items are picked and packed annually, while delivery teams work to get orders to customers on time. Safety is the top priority, and the operations culture is defined by teamwork, diversity, and a shared work ethic that keeps the business running smoothly. The team takes pride in delivering the quality service Amazon is known for globally.

Key job responsibilities
As an Amazon operations intern, you'll have the opportunity to apply your analytical skills to impactful projects that enhance the functionality and service of Fulfillment Centers, Sortation Centers, and Delivery Stations. Key aspects of the role include:

- Completing high-priority projects to the highest standard, demonstrating your ability to deliver results

- Analyzing data to identify operational challenges and opportunities for improvement

- Proposing and testing solutions, collaborating with the team to implement the most effective ones

- Developing communication and teamwork skills by working with managers, stakeholders, and frontline associates.

- Be on the move within the building to engage with various teams. This includes actively gathering knowledge by participating in activities such as pre-briefs, flow meetings, and discussions with the leadership team and associates.

- Ability to navigate the workspace and move between different areas is essential for this position.

- Displaying flexibility to work various schedules and shift patterns as required.

- Potential relocation to the designated work location.
